Sec. 12.5. (a) This section does not apply to the filing of a recount petition, contest petition, or cross-petition under IC 3-12-11.
(b) Notwithstanding IC 3-5-4-1.7, the state recount commission may receive filings by electronic mail from attorneys representing an individual or party in a recount or contest proceeding following the filing of the original recount petition, contest petition, or cross-petition.
